    Tuples are only defined for simple types.
    This means that defining tuples like
    
    let t:(R*R);
    
    is forbidden. This may change in future, but it does not seem a
    limitations and probably leads to simpler syntax.
    
    Now, when the used type is not simple, it is clearly indicated.
